What is this form?

A Customer Confidentiality Agreement, often referred to as a nondisclosure agreement, is a legal document that ensures sensitive information exchanged between a company and a customer is kept confidential. This agreement protects proprietary data and trade secrets, providing assurance that both parties recognize their obligation to maintain confidentiality. Unlike other agreements, it specifically addresses the handling of confidential materials delivered during the potential review of systems or services.

Key components of this form

  • Identification of the parties involved, including the Company and Customer.
  • Provisions for the delivery and review of functional documentation by the Company.
  • A definition of what constitutes "Confidential Information" and the obligations associated with it.
  • Specifics on how the Customer must manage and return confidential materials.
  • Signatures from authorized representatives of both parties to validate the agreement.

Situations where this form applies

This form is useful in scenarios where a company intends to share proprietary information with a customer during discussions about potential collaboration or system implementation. It ensures that any sensitive information shared during these interactions is legally protected from unauthorized disclosure, thereby safeguarding the interests of both parties.

Typical mistakes to avoid

  • Failing to clearly define what constitutes confidential information.
  • Not including signatures from authorized representatives.
  • Neglecting to specify the duration of the confidentiality obligation.
  • Using vague language that could lead to misinterpretation of the terms.

Confidentiality agreements usually allow the recipient to disclose confidential information if required to do so by court order or other legal process.

Here's some breach of confidentiality examples you could find yourself facing: Saving sensitive information on an unsecure computer that leaves the data accessible to others. Sharing employees' personal data, like payroll details, bank details, home addresses and medical records.
